  • Publication number: 20220340286
    Abstract: A hybrid air mobility system is capable of flying a long distance through effective operation of an engine and batteries. The hybrid air mobility system includes a fuselage configured to supply power to a propeller and electric equipment, the fuselage being provided with a duct including an inlet and an outlet so as to circulate air to the engine and the electric equipment; a deflector rotatably installed at the outlet of the duct so as to convert a discharge direction of exhaust gas generated by the engine and cooling air after cooling the electric equipment; and a controller configured to determine whether or not the engine is driven and to control a rotated position of the deflector depending on an amount of driving of the engine so as to selectively adjust movement of the exhaust gas and the cooling air towards the propeller.

  • Publication number: 20220204172
    Abstract: A power management system for an air mobility vehicle includes a plurality of batteries configured to provide power to a propulsion unit of the air mobility vehicle to propel the air mobility vehicle, and a discharge control unit configured to monitor an operation state and a charge state of each battery, determine a discharge mode of each of the plurality of batteries according to the monitored operation state and the monitored charge state, and control whether each of the plurality of batteries is discharged or a discharge rate thereof according to the determined discharge mode.

  • Publication number: 20220194566
    Abstract: A noise reduction system for air mobility, may include a plurality of propeller modules provided on the air mobility and each including an inverter, a motor electrically connected to the inverter, and a propeller mounted to the motor; and a control unit configured to perform PWM control of power to be provided to the inverters to reduce noise attributable to carrier frequencies generated by the plurality of inverters or reduce noise attributable to fundamental frequencies generated by the plurality of motors.

  • Publication number: 20220200265
    Abstract: An emergency power management system of a mobility, may include a fuse device connected to a battery and including a first circuit and a second circuit in which a first fuse and a second fuse are respectively provided and are connected in parallel, a pyro switch provided between the first circuit and the second circuit, and configured to establish electric connection with the first circuit in ordinary times and to release electric connection with the first circuit and to establish electric connection with the second circuit in a case of emergency, a determiner configured to determine abnormality of the first fuse based on current applied from the high-voltage battery or voltages at opposite end portions of the first fuse, and a controller configured to operate the pyro switch when abnormality occurs in the first fuse.

  • Publication number: 20220194618
    Abstract: An air mobility vehicle may include air flaps located under a mounting position of each of rotary wings and rotatably mounted inside openings to guide a flow direction of air flowing to a region under each of the rotary wings or air flowing above the openings to inside of the air mobility vehicle, an actuator coupled to the air flaps and configured to rotate the air flaps to direct the air having passed through the air flaps to a motor, an inverter, or the motor and the inverter of each of the rotary wings, or batteries, and a controller electrically connected to the actuator and configured to control a flow of the air having passed through the air flaps by controlling the actuator depending on a driving state of the air mobility vehicle or temperatures of the motor and the inverter of each of the rotary wings or a temperature of the batteries.

  • Publication number: 20220144443
    Abstract: A hybrid air mobility vehicle can make a long-distance flight through an efficient operation of an engine and a battery, and can reduce discomfort by reducing noise according to flight surroundings. The hybrid air mobility vehicle includes: an engine and a generator; a battery and a drive motor electrically connected to the generator; a first propeller connected to the drive motor and a second propeller connected to the generator through a clutch; and a controller that controls driving of the engine, the clutch, and the drive motor, based on a flight factor including at least one of a flight mode, a required power, a battery charging amount, or a surrounding flight environment of the hybrid air mobility vehicle.

  • Publication number: 20220119100
    Abstract: In an air mobility vehicle, an engine operates as required to provide mechanical driving force or electric energy. A battery is charged with the electric energy from the engine. Main rotors operate using the electric energy of the battery and electric power generated by the engine to perform takeoff, landing, and cruising. Auxiliary rotors are disposed at or adjacent to the center of gravity of a vehicle body and mechanically connected to the engine via a clutch. The auxiliary rotors perform the takeoff, the landing, or the cruising by receiving the mechanical driving force from the engine when the clutch is in an engaged position. A controller monitors the states of the battery and the main rotors and controls the operations of the engine and the clutch.

  • Publication number: 20220103042
    Abstract: A motor apparatus has a cooling structure capable of effectively cooling the motor by inducing a fluid flow into the motor. In particular, the motor apparatus includes: a first part having a first flow path and a motor installed thereon; a second part having a second flow path and configured to be rotatably mounted on the first part and connected to the motor; and a turbine portion coupled to the second part and including disks stacked on one another forming spaces therebetween. When the turbine portion is rotated together with the second part, air is drawn through the first flow path or the second flow path and introduced into an opening hole of each of the disks, and the air is discharged into the spaces formed between the respective disks to cool the motor.

  • Patent number: 10149170
    Abstract: A method and an apparatus for controlling an adaptive flow in a wireless communication system is provided. A method of a master base station in a wireless communication system, in which base stations having different cell sizes coexist, comprises the steps of: receiving load information from at least one other base station, receiving channel information about the at least one other base station from a terminal connected to the master base station, determining a secondary base station capable of load sharing for the terminal on basis of the channel information and the load information, and requesting, from the terminal, a further connection to the secondary base station. Offloading for downlink transmission of the terminal is determined based on the load information of a small cell. Furthermore, a resource distribution ratio for downlink transmission of the terminal is determined based on channel quality information reported from the terminal.

  • Patent number: 9794799
    Abstract: Methods and apparatuses are provided for performing carrier aggregation (CA) using a plurality of almost blank subframe (ABS) patterns in a macro enhanced Node B (eNB) of a wireless communication system connected to a heterogeneous network. An ABS pattern having a different pattern is determined for each component carrier (CC), when two or more carriers are deployed in each of the macro eNB and at least one small cell eNB. A serving cell for each user equipment (UE) is determined for each CC, from among a macro cell and a small cell. CA is performed for data transmission to each UE using the determined ABS pattern, in accordance with each determined serving cell.
